Career path

Genetic Diversity & Healthcare: UK Career Outlook

Career Role Description
Genetic Counselor (Clinical Genetics) Provides genetic counseling and support to individuals and families affected by genetic disorders; high demand due to advancements in genomic medicine.
Genomic Scientist (Research & Development) Conducts research on genetic diversity and its implications for health; crucial role in developing personalized medicine strategies.
Bioinformatician (Data Analysis) Analyzes large genomic datasets to identify patterns related to health and disease; essential for understanding genetic diversity.
Pharmacogenomics Specialist (Drug Development) Develops and implements pharmacogenomic testing and strategies for optimizing drug therapy based on genetic profiles.
Public Health Geneticist (Epidemiology) Investigates the role of genetic factors in population health and disease, focusing on genetic diversity and its impact on public health initiatives.
